Curtain wall glass clamp and point support curtain wall thereof Technical Field The utility model belongs to the technical field of fixtures and curtain walls thereof, and particularly relates to a curtain wall glass fixture and a point-supported curtain wall thereof. Background The point-supported curtain wall is an important branch of a curtain wall technology and is characterized in that traditional line or plane supports are replaced by point-shaped connection, a small number of supporting points are arranged at the edges or corners of glass, the visual integrity of the glass is reserved to the greatest extent, the curtain wall glass clamp is a device for accurately positioning and fixing the glass through a mechanical structure, and the point-supported curtain wall has the core functions of balancing external forces such as dead weight and wind load of the glass and simultaneously ensuring safe and reliable connection between the glass and a supporting structure. The prior curtain wall clamp is provided with a rubber gasket (or a rubber sealing sheet) so as to improve the bonding performance between the clamp and the curtain wall, such as the rubber sealing sheet shown in the prior patent glass curtain wall clamp structure (bulletin number: CN 221627363U); However, the rubber sealing sheets are exposed in the air, the rubber sealing sheets can be affected gradually under the irradiation of the sun and under the flushing of rainwater, ultraviolet rays lead to the breakage of rubber molecular chains, surface cracking, hardening and elasticity loss, even pulverization, gaps are easy to generate at joints after the sealing sheets lose elasticity, water leakage and ventilation are caused, the air tightness and the water tightness of the curtain wall are damaged, and as the rubber sealing sheets are arranged between the curtain wall and a clamp, maintenance holes or quick dismounting structures for replacing the sealing sheets are not reserved in most curtain wall designs, so that the large dismounting and mounting are needed during replacement, and the problem of inconvenience in replacing the rubber sealing sheets is caused; Therefore, the scheme provides a curtain wall glass clamp and a point support curtain wall thereof, so as to solve the problem. Disclosure of utility model The utility model aims to provide a curtain wall glass clamp and a point support curtain wall thereof, which are used for solving the problems that a large-scale disassembly and assembly are needed during replacement due to the fact that a maintenance hole or a quick disassembly and assembly structure for replacing sealing sheets is not reserved in the existing majority of curtain wall designs, and the rubber sealing sheets are inconvenient to replace.
